The ONE:MOORE 1000 is a modular mooring system that can be combined into larger mooring stations, accommodating even the largest vessels with ease. Perfectly suited for ferry and Ro-Ro routes, this system is optimized for frequent operations at the same berths.

In challenging environments where traditional mooring lines are impractical, the ONE:MOORE 1000 can be configured for semi-automatic operation, ensuring flexibility and reliability. With built-in redundancy and a proven track record, it delivers exceptional performance even in the most demanding conditions.

Designed with safety as a top priority, the ONE:MOORE 1000 significantly enhances work safety by eliminating the need for rope handling. By removing the risks associated with snap-back and minimizing worker proximity to water, it reduces the most hazardous aspects of dock operations, ensuring a safer working environment for dockworkers.

In fully automatic configuration the system has a full duplex radio link to the ship and in the semi-automatic version the link is simplex. Both versions can be supplied with full integration to the ship IAS system and/or as a standalone system with its own console.

T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S

Frame size:

1000 kN

SWL Brest holding capacity:

100 tonnes / module

SWL Longitudinal capacity

Depending on arrangement

Roll damping:

Optional

ECO-power mode:

Standard

Main power peak requirement:

11 kW / module

Radio link:

Option Wireless CAN / Wireless MODBUS

Remote service access:

4G

Hull fitting:

Option recessed or protruding

Delivery options:

Turn-key or machine + installation support

Onboard console:

Option ONEARC console or integrate with ship IAS

UPS:

Standard
